Blast Finishing with Corncobs
In the realm of surface finishing, a novel and eco-friendly approach has emerged: corncob blasting. This innovative process utilizes compressed air to propel processed corncobs against materials, effectively removing rust, paint, scale, and other contaminants. Corncobs, being a naturally degradable resource, present a green alternative to traditional abrasive blasting methods that often utilize harmful materials like sand or steel grit.
- Advantages of corncob blasting include reduced environmental impact, improved workplace safety due to the soft nature of corncobs, and a refined finish on a variety of materials.
